Handwriting Activity: Letter Formation Practice

Objective: To help students improve their letter formation skills.

Materials: - Writing paper - Pencil or pen

Instructions: 1. Start by choosing a letter that the student needs to work on. For example, the letter “a”. 2. Write the letter “a” on the board or on a piece of paper as a model for the student to follow. 3. Ask the student to practice writing the letter “a” on their own paper. Encourage them to take their time and focus on forming the letter correctly. 4. Once the student has written the letter “a” a few times, ask them to circle the best one they wrote. 5. Next, ask the student to write a word that starts with the letter “a” on their paper. For example, “apple”. 6. Encourage the student to use their best letter formation skills to write the word neatly and accurately. 7. Finally, ask the student to read the word they wrote out loud.

Variations: - Choose a different letter for each session. - Have the student write a sentence using the word they wrote. - Use different colored pencils or pens to make the activity more engaging. - Have the student write the letter in uppercase and lowercase forms.
